ImageWasher उपयोगकर्ता गाइड
परिचय और सिद्धांत
डिजिटल छवियों में अक्सर छुपा हुआ मेटाडेटा होता है, जो फ़ाइल के भीतर एम्बेडेड पाठ-आधारित जानकारी है। इस मेटाडेटा में संवेदनशील विवरण शामिल हो सकते हैं जैसे फोटोग्राफर की व्यक्तिगत जानकारी, अद्वितीय छवि पहचानकर्ता, और यहां तक कि छवि AI-जनित थी या नहीं।
ऐसी जानकारी ऑनलाइन छवियां साझा करने या अपलोड करने पर जोखिम पैदा कर सकती है, जिसमें व्यक्तिगत डेटा एक्सपोज़र, छवि ट्रैकिंग, और अनधिकृत उपयोग शामिल है।
हालांकि, केवल मेटाडेटा हटाना छवि की विशिष्टता सुनिश्चित करने के लिए पर्याप्त नहीं है। ImageWasher पिक्सेल स्तर पर छवि को ही बदलकर आगे बढ़ता है, एक दृष्टिगत रूप से समान लेकिन डेटा के मामले में पूरी तरह से अद्वितीय छवि बनाता है।
पैरामीटर और सेटिंग्स
1. 1. प्रारूप बदलें
आउटपुट छवि प्रारूप को बदलता है। सक्षम होने पर, सभी प्रसंस्कृत छवियां निर्दिष्ट प्रारूप में सहेजी जाएंगी।
प्रारूप
- PNG: हानिरहित प्रारूप, पारदर्शिता का समर्थन करता है। गुणवत्ता को संरक्षित करने की आवश्यकता वाली छवियों के लिए सबसे अच्छा।
- JPG: हानिपूर्ण प्रारूप, छोटा फ़ाइल आकार। गुणवत्ता सेटिंग उपलब्ध (0.0-1.0)।
- WebP: आधुनिक प्रारूप, गुणवत्ता और फ़ाइल आकार के बीच अच्छा संतुलन। गुणवत्ता सेटिंग उपलब्ध (0.0-1.0)।
गुणवत्ता
JPG और WebP प्रारूपों के लिए उपलब्ध। सीमा: 0.0 से 1.0। डिफ़ॉल्ट: 0.8।
• 1.0 = उच्चतम गुणवत्ता (सबसे बड़ा फ़ाइल आकार)
• 0.0 = निम्नतम गुणवत्ता (सबसे छोटा फ़ाइल आकार)
• आम तौर पर, वेब छवियां (JPG/WebP) आमतौर पर 0.7 से 0.9 के आसपास गुणवत्ता स्तर पर सहेजी जाती हैं, 0.8 गुणवत्ता और फ़ाइल आकार के बीच एक अच्छा संतुलन है।
2. 2. पैटर्न ओवरले
पिक्सेल स्तर पर छवि पर यादृच्छिक शोर पैटर्न ओवरले लागू करता है। यह मुख्य विशेषता है जो दृश्य उपस्थिति को संरक्षित करते हुए अंतर्निहित डेटा को पूरी तरह से बदलकर छवि विशिष्टता सुनिश्चित करती है।
अपारदर्शिता (%)
पैटर्न ओवरले की तीव्रता को नियंत्रित करता है। सीमा: 0 से 100%। डिफ़ॉल्ट: 1.5%।
• कम मान (0.5-2%): लगभग अदृश्य, न्यूनतम दृश्य परिवर्तन
• उच्च मान (5-10%): अधिक ध्यान देने योग्य, लेकिन अभी भी सूक्ष्म
• अनुशंसित: अदृश्यता और डेटा परिवर्तन के बीच सर्वोत्तम संतुलन के लिए 1-3%
नोट: यह छवि विशिष्टता सुनिश्चित करने के लिए सबसे महत्वपूर्ण विशेषता है। बहुत कम अपारदर्शिता के साथ भी, पिक्सेल-स्तरीय डेटा पूरी तरह से बदल जाता है, जिससे मूल छवि को पुनर्प्राप्त करना असंभव हो जाता है।
3. 3. बॉर्डर
छवि के चारों ओर एक बॉर्डर जोड़ता है। यह छवि में एक अलग वस्तु जोड़ता है, विशिष्टता को और बढ़ाता है।
चौड़ाई
बॉर्डर मोटाई। पिक्सेल (px) या प्रतिशत (%) में निर्दिष्ट किया जा सकता है।
• प्रतिशत: छवि की छोटी भुजा के सापेक्ष (डिफ़ॉल्ट: 1%)
• पिक्सेल: पिक्सेल में निरपेक्ष मान
• डिफ़ॉल्ट: 1%
अपारदर्शिता (%)
बॉर्डर पारदर्शिता। सीमा: 0 से 100%। डिफ़ॉल्ट: 100% (पूरी तरह से अपारदर्शी)।
रंग
बॉर्डर रंग। रंग पिकर का उपयोग करके चुना जा सकता है या हेक्स कोड के रूप में दर्ज किया जा सकता है (उदाहरण के लिए, काले रंग के लिए #000000)।
• डिफ़ॉल्ट: #000000 (काला)
यादृच्छिक बॉर्डर
सक्षम होने पर, यादृच्छिक चौड़ाई, अपारदर्शिता, और रंग के साथ प्रत्येक छवि के लिए एक यादृच्छिक बॉर्डर उत्पन्न करता है।
• सक्षम होने पर, मैनुअल चौड़ाई, अपारदर्शिता, और रंग सेटिंग्स को अनदेखा किया जाता है
• प्रत्येक प्रसंस्कृत छवि में एक अद्वितीय यादृच्छिक बॉर्डर होगा
4. 4. चमक
छवि की चमक को यादृच्छिक रूप से समायोजित करता है। यह भिन्नता बनाने के लिए पिक्सेल मानों को संशोधित करता है।
सीमा (%)
अधिकतम चमक भिन्नता सीमा। सीमा: 0 से 100%। डिफ़ॉल्ट: 10%।
• वास्तविक समायोजन -Range% और +Range% के बीच यादृच्छिक रूप से चुना जाता है
• उदाहरण: सीमा 10% का मतलब है कि चमक -10% से +10% तक भिन्न हो सकती है
• कम मान (5-10%): सूक्ष्म परिवर्तन, मुश्किल से ध्यान देने योग्य
• उच्च मान (20-50%): अधिक ध्यान देने योग्य चमक परिवर्तन
5. 5. संतृप्ति
छवि के रंग संतृप्ति को यादृच्छिक रूप से समायोजित करता है। यह भिन्नता बनाने के लिए रंग तीव्रता को संशोधित करता है।
सीमा (%)
अधिकतम संतृप्ति भिन्नता सीमा। सीमा: 0 से 100%। डिफ़ॉल्ट: 10%।
• वास्तविक समायोजन -Range% और +Range% के बीच यादृच्छिक रूप से चुना जाता है
• उदाहरण: सीमा 10% का मतलब है कि संतृप्ति -10% से +10% तक भिन्न हो सकती है
• कम मान (5-10%): सूक्ष्म रंग परिवर्तन
• उच्च मान (20-50%): अधिक ध्यान देने योग्य रंग तीव्रता परिवर्तन
6. 6. आकार
निर्दिष्ट सीमा के भीतर छवि को यादृच्छिक रूप से आकार बदलता है। यह छवि आयामों को संशोधित करता है, पिक्सेल डेटा को और बदलता है।
सीमा (%)
अधिकतम आकार भिन्नता सीमा। सीमा: 0 से 100%। डिफ़ॉल्ट: 10%।
• वास्तविक समायोजन -Range% और +Range% के बीच यादृच्छिक रूप से चुना जाता है
• उदाहरण: सीमा 10% का मतलब है कि आकार मूल के 90% से 110% तक भिन्न हो सकता है
• कम मान (5-10%): न्यूनतम आकार परिवर्तन, मुश्किल से ध्यान देने योग्य
• उच्च मान (20-50%): अधिक ध्यान देने योग्य आकार परिवर्तन
• आकार बदलते समय पहलू अनुपात बनाए रखा जाता है
उपयोग युक्तियां
- •पैटर्न ओवरले छवि विशिष्टता सुनिश्चित करने के लिए सबसे महत्वपूर्ण विशेषता है। अधिकतम गोपनीयता सुरक्षा के लिए इसे हमेशा सक्षम करें।
- •न्यूनतम दृश्य परिवर्तन के लिए, पैटर्न ओवरले (1-2%) के साथ चमक (5-10%) और संतृप्ति (5-10%) का उपयोग करें।
- •अधिकतम विशिष्टता के लिए, मध्यम सेटिंग्स के साथ सभी विशेषताओं को सक्षम करें। यह सुनिश्चित करता है कि छवि डेटा पूरी तरह से बदल जाता है।
- •सभी यादृच्छिक समायोजन प्रति छवि लागू होते हैं, इसलिए समान सेटिंग्स के साथ भी प्रत्येक प्रसंस्कृत छवि अद्वितीय होगी।
- •अन्य सेटिंग्स की परवाह किए बिना मेटाडेटा हमेशा हटा दिया जाता है।